Objective
THE RAPID DEVELOPMENT OF MACHINE AND COMPUTER TECHNOLOGY HAS LEFT MANY PARTS OF THE CERAMICS INDUSTRY BEHIND. COMPANIES WITHIN THE INDUSTRY RECOGNISE THIS SHORTFALL BUT ARE UNABLE TO AFFORD THE RESEARCH INTO THE TECHNOLOGY DUE TO THEIR SIZE. THE RESEARCH AIMS TO COVER: 1. THE REDUCTION IN LEAD TIMES DUE TO IMPLEMENTATION OF NEW TECHNOLOGY 2. DEVELOPMENT OF METHODOLOGY 3. OPTIMUM METHODS OF DATA TRANSFER 4. INTEGRATION OF RP AND RM INTO A CERAMICS INDUSTRIAL ENVIRONMENT 5. IMPROVE COMPETITION WITH OVERSEAS MARKETS IE: USA, JAPAN 6. IDENTIFY CORRECT LEVEL OF INTRODUCTION
